SYRIAN ENERGY MINISTER DISCUSSES COOPERATION, GAS SUPPLY WITH IRAQI OIL MINISTER
Syrian Energy Minister, Mohammed al-Bashir, discussed on Thursday with Iraqi Oil Minister, Hayyan Abdul Ghani, ways of enhancing cooperation between the two countries in the energy sector, in a way that serves mutual interests and benefits both states. During a phone call, the two sides praised joint efforts to begin exporting Iraqi oil through the Syrian territory, pointing to the possibility of supplying domestic gas to Syria to boost energy security and meet local needs. The talks also addressed the rehabilitation of oil pipelines, particularly the Kirkuk-Banias one, as to contribute to developing and strengthening the oil export process. The Iraqi Oil Minister said that this cooperation will continue sustainably and will not be connected to current circumstances or the ongoing war, stressing his country’s commitment to developing bilateral relations in this vital sector. The first shipments of Iraqi fuel arrived at Banias refinery tanks via al-Tanf border crossing, in preparation for exporting it to global markets. (ICE BEIRUT)
